Runbook — Textgate encoding detection

When users report garbled characters in uploaded text files, check the charset sniffer in the Textgate ingest pod first. The detector samples the first 64 KB; files that open with a UTF-16 BOM but contain mixed line endings often get misclassified as Latin-1. Restart the sniffer worker, then re-run detection on the stuck queue with the replay script. If more than 5% of files still fail, escalate to the Parsewell team. Include the token below in your escalation ticket.

pipeline stamp: htk6_7941f2

Hey, welcome aboard! Quick handover on Alertsift, our on-call alert deduplicator. It groups pages by fingerprint and squashes repeats within a 10-minute window. Watch the Redis queue — if it backs up, dedupe silently stops and everyone gets spammed. Runbook's on the Birchway wiki under Alertsift Ops. If anything looks weird, don't guess — ping the service owner directly.

named custodian: Rusion Joreth Holvan Norwyn

Step 4 — Shipping Driftpane (our big-file diff viewer)

Build the chunked-rendering bundle first; Driftpane streams diffs in 2MB slices, so don't skip the worker assets or huge files will just spin forever. Run the smoke test against the 500MB fixture in the perf folder — if scrolling stutters, bump the slice cache before releasing. When everything passes, you're ready to sign the artifact. Paste the deploy key below so the uploader can authenticate.

deploy key for kagup-bageg: bky4_6i6U

Subject: Quickstore 4.2 — bloom filter now fronts the KV layer

Plugin authors: starting with this release, Quickstore places a bloom filter ahead of the key-value store. Negative lookups return faster; false positives fall through safely. No API changes are required on your side. Verify your plugin against the staging build referenced below.

session token of fahif-tadup = htk3_9c7

## Step 4: Swap the Planner Flag

After upgrading Quernstone to 3.2, the query planner sometimes picks a sequential scan on the `orders_flat` table — yeah, it's a known regression. Set `planner.force_index_hints = true` before running the backfill, otherwise the job crawls. Verify against staging first; it connects with the following string.

warehouse DSN: mssql://rusdor_svc:0FSWCn9@db-951a.paliqforge.local:5432/ulawyn